
Fig. 12.3. Manual transmission (iB5), which is equipped with all models of cars since 1996
Fiesta cars are equipped with a five-speed gearbox (Fig. 12.3). All forward gears are fully synchronized, and the first three gears even have double synchronizers. Depending on the engine model, gearboxes with different gear ratios are installed. Gearbox operation
Torque from the engine crankshaft is transmitted through the clutch to the primary shaft of the gearbox. The primary shaft has five helical gears and a reverse gear, which are in constant engagement with the gears on the secondary shaft. The gears on the secondary shaft are mounted on needle bearings and rotate freely on the shaft until a certain gear is engaged in the gear shift mechanism.
Gears and shafts
When a gear is engaged, the corresponding pinion is locked with the secondary shaft of the gearbox. The ratio of the number of teeth of the engaged pair of pinions ultimately provides the corresponding gear. When shifting gears, no connection is made between the pinions - the connection is made between the pinion and the shaft. The gearshift lever acts on the fork, which, through the clutch, provides a rigid kinematic connection of the pinions. To equalize the rotational speeds of the shaft and pinion, synchronizers consisting of several elements are used. The faster rotating shaft is slowed down by friction until a connection with the transmission of torque is made at a uniform rotational speed. Since it takes a short time to synchronize the rotational speeds, it is not recommended to press hard on the gearshift lever, especially with a cold engine and thick transmission oil.
Forward and reverse gears
The Fiesta's first three gears rotate at a speed lower than the engine crankshaft. In fourth gear, the ratio is 0.95:1, and the driven gears rotate at a higher speed than the engine crankshaft. Experts talk about a "long" gear, which maintains the optimum power characteristics of Ford engines. In fifth gear (gear ratio 0.76:1), the "scissors" - the difference in engine and drive speeds - are even greater, which preserves the engine and reduces fuel consumption, especially over long distances. When shifting all forward gears, two gears are used. Only three gears are used for reverse gear. The third gear, also called the intermediate gear, is located on a separate shaft and is only engaged when it is necessary to change the direction of rotation of the drive shaft to ensure reverse gear.
